Checking the condition of the bulb sockets
The following procedure applies to all of the bulb
sockets.
1. Check:
• Bulb socket (for continuity)
(with the pocket tester)
No continuity → Replace.
Pocket tester
90890-03112
Analog pocket tester
YU-03112-C
TIP
Check each bulb socket for continuity in the
same manner as described in the bulb section;
however, note the following.

a. Install a good bulb into the bulb socket.
b. Connect the pocket tester probes to the re-
spective leads of the bulb socket.
c. Check the bulb socket for continuity. If any of
the readings indicate no continuity, replace
the bulb socket.

CHECKING THE FUSES
The following procedure applies to all of the fus-
es.
EC3P61003
NOTICE
To avoid a short circuit, always turn the main
switch to "OFF" when checking or replacing
a fuse.
1. Remove:
• Right upper inner panel
Refer to "GENERAL CHASSIS" on page 4-1.
2. Check:
• Fuse
▼▼▼
▼ ▼▼▼
▼ ▼▼▼
a. Connect the pocket tester to the fuse and
check the continuity.
TIP
Set the pocket tester selector to "Ω × 1".
Pocket tester
90890-03112
Analog pocket tester
YU-03112-C
b. If the pocket tester indicates "∞", replace the
fuse.

3. Replace:
• Blown fuse
▼▼▼
▼ ▼▼▼
a. Turn the main switch to "OFF".
b. Install a new fuse of the correct amperage
rating.
c. Set on the switches to verify if the electrical
circuit is operational.
d. If the fuse immediately blows again, check
the electrical circuit.
